I have been looking at the possibility of a jobo processor and the CPP looks 
best but:
I don't really have room for it at the moment and it seems like you need to 
pour chemicals and empty/tip it so what is the real benefit over using just a 
roller base and hand rotating? Obviously the temperature control looks like it 
is the main benefit but after that I'm not sure about how much  benefit their 
is. 
An ATL-1500 on the other hand, is fully automatic although it doesn't take 
expert drums. Problem is that the ATL-1500 is expensive!!! £2800 new.

For now I have ordered a roller base to see how I get on with that. If it turns 
out to be a real pain to use, would a cpp processor really make things much 
easier.
